Within the organisation of the Chief Marketing Officer (CMO) for Gripen, we are looking for an experienced professional to take responsibility for international Gripen campaigns. In this role, you will lead a dynamic team, with the objective of securing the Gripen E/F program.
Your role
You will join the Gripen CMO team, a group of experienced marketing and sales professionals with backgrounds spanning program and product management, operational air-force officers, and business professionals. The team’s focus is to run and secure Gripen sales campaigns in the global market.
As a Gripen Campaign Director, you will have a broad scope and a central role in a complex, international environment, working closely with a wide range of stakeholders. A key aspect of the role is the importance of being able to engage and address stakeholders at all levels. This includes armed forces personnel, media representatives, partner companies, and political decision-makers.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Leading the campaign in line with objectives set by Saab management and the CMO organisation.
- Develop campaign capture strategies and translate them into clear, comprehensive plans covering objectives, target audiences, approaches, tactics, budgets, and timelines.
- Leading the campaign team in a structured and effective way, guided by values and leadership principles.
- Following market developments, including trends, shifts in customer behaviour, and competitor activity, and adapting the campaign accordingly.
- Monitor performance and assess the impact of marketing and sales activities, adjusting as needed to improve outcomes.
You will report to the CMO Gripen and will initially be based in Linköping or at another relevant Saab site in Sweden. In the future, the position will be located in the campaign country.
International travel will be required on a regular basis.

Saab is a leading defence and security company with an enduring mission, to help nations keep their people and society safe. Empowered by its 26,100 talented people, Saab constantly pushes the boundaries of technology to create a safer and more sustainable world.
Saab designs, manufactures and maintains advanced systems in aeronautics, weapons, command and control, sensors and underwater systems. Saab is headquartered in Sweden.
